Synopsis: |
This indispensable and fully revised new edition has been designed specifically to meet the needs of students on the Teaching Assistant Foundation Degree course, and provides a highly accessible overview of the modern Teaching Assistant's role Packed full of comprehensive yet thoroughly grounded advice and practical tasks, this book includes sections covering all the different ideas, situations and problems that a Teaching Assistant can expect to encounter, including: * Personal professional development - helping Teaching Assistants to understand their role and workplace. * Growth, development and learning - introducing the basic theories of human development and learning. * Behaviour management - exploring strategies that encourage and support appropriate behaviour * Today's curriculum - how learning takes place in literacy, mathematics, science and technology. * Understanding inclusive education - exploring access, participation and additional needs for specific groups of young people. This new edition makes updates throughout in relation the Teaching Assistant's role.Taking into account the change in Government, the authors include a range of quotations and illustrations from day-to-day practice based on their own formal observations and provide a greater insight into the multiple roles of the teaching assistant. Each chapter provides exercises and reflective activities to embed the learning undertaken. Along with task lists, discussion points, ideas, summary points and notes on further reading, this textbook will be the essential companion for all Foundation Degree students. It will also be invaluable reading for any NVQ students and practising Teaching Assistants, as well as those who teach or manage them. |
